Transaction 63f58621b84ee2986e1f1eb481fef3bf9fe16b46462b30bfd13f74ebe262a7eb

2 Input
2 Outputs
  • 63f58621b84ee2986e1f1eb481fef3bf9fe16b46462b30bfd13f74ebe262a7eb:0
  • value  156760
    address  13tfxiZwQHQ3yMDQQ3S3Xt3NGihvLFGm6C
  • 63f58621b84ee2986e1f1eb481fef3bf9fe16b46462b30bfd13f74ebe262a7eb:1
  • value  1410802
    address  1QF41RTj1Ltwmf8CW9qBk68rFp1RC12qy9